STATUTORY RULES.

1940. No. 110.

 

REGULATIONS UNDER THE COMMONWEALTH PUBLIC SERVICE ACT 1922-1939.*

THE PUBLIC SERVICE BOARD appointed under the Commonwealth Public Service Act 1922-1939, in pursuance and exercise of the authority conferred upon it by the said Act, and subject to the approval of the Governor-General, hereby makes the following Regulations.

Dated this fifteenth day of June, 1940.

F. G. THORPE

Commissioner.

I, THE DEPUTY OF THE GOVERNOR-GENERAL in and over the Commonwealth of Australia, acting with the advice of the Federal Executive Council, hereby approve the following Regulations.

Dated this fifteenth day of June, 1940.

WINSTON DUGAN

Deputy of the Governor-General.

By His Excellency’s Command,

ROBERT G. MENZIES

Prime Minister.

_________

Amendments of the Commonwealth Public Service Regulations.†

Permanent Heads to be Chief Officers.

1. Regulation 71 of the Commonwealth Public Service Regulations is amended by adding the following Department at the end of the list of Departments set forth in sub-regulation (1.) thereof:—

“The Department of Munitions.”.

Permanent Heads of Departments.

2. Regulation 71a of the Commonwealth Public Service Regulations is amended by adding at the end thereof the words—

“The Secretary, Department of Munitions.”.
